6P6Y

Crystal structure of voltage-gated sodium channel NavAb V100C/Q150C disulfide crosslinked mutant in the activated state

Summary for 6P6Y
Entry DOI10.2210/pdb6p6y/pdb
DescriptorIon transport protein, 3-[(3-CHOLAMIDOPROPYL)DIMETHYLAMMONIO]-1-PROPANESULFONATE, 1,2-DIMYRISTOYL-SN-GLYCERO-3-PHOSPHOCHOLINE (3 entities in total)
Functional Keywordsion channel, ion transport protein, membrane protein, metal transport
Biological sourceArcobacter butzleri (strain RM4018)
Total number of polymer chains1
Total formula weight34392.77
Authors
Wisedchaisri, G.,Tonggu, L.,McCord, E.,Gamal El-din, T.M.,Wang, L.,Zheng, N.,Catterall, W.A. (deposition date: 2019-06-04, release date: 2019-08-14, Last modification date: 2023-10-11)
Primary citationWisedchaisri, G.,Tonggu, L.,McCord, E.,Gamal El-Din, T.M.,Wang, L.,Zheng, N.,Catterall, W.A.
Resting-State Structure and Gating Mechanism of a Voltage-Gated Sodium Channel.
Cell, 178:993-, 2019
Cited by
PubMed: 31353218
DOI: 10.1016/j.cell.2019.06.031
PDB entries with the same primary citation
Experimental method
X-RAY DIFFRACTION (2.89 Å)
